Rippling Off Campus Drive 2025 hiring Software Engineer Job, Bangalore

September 4, 2025

Apply for Rippling Off Campus Drive 2025! Hiring Software Engineer Job in Bangalore for 1–2 years. Build Python, Go, AWS integrations. Competitive salary for BE/BTech graduates skilled in distributed systems, Kafka.

Candidates who are interested in Rippling Off Campus Drive Job Openings can go through the below to get more information.

Key Job details of Software Engineer job

Company: Rippling

Qualifications: BE/BTech

Experience Needed: 1–2 years

Location: Bangalore

Job Description

Rippling’s Accounting Integrations team is on a mission to automate the flow of financial data between Rippling’s core products—such as Payroll, Spend, Travel, and Procurement—and external ERPs like NetSuite, QuickBooks, and Xero. We own the underlying infrastructure that enables seamless, bi-directional sync between Rippling’s platform and these accounting systems. Our work is critical to enabling accounting books closure: a real-time accounting model that helps finance teams move away from manual, month-end fire drills toward strategic, high-impact work.

As an SDE-I on the team, you’ll contribute to high-impact projects by building scalable, reliable systems that automate key financial processes like data synchronization and reconciliation. You’ll collaborate with senior engineers, product managers, and cross-functional teams to deliver features that ensure accuracy, compliance, and visibility into our customers’ financial data.

This is a high-ownership role where you’ll contribute to both new product capabilities and improvements to existing infrastructure. You’ll also have the opportunity to work on enterprise-grade integrations as Rippling expands into global markets and supports more complex accounting use cases.

If you’re a strong backend engineer who enjoys solving real-world business problems at scale, we’d love to work with you.

What you will do

  • Collaborate with engineers, product managers, and designers to build robust and scalable accounting integration features.
  • Design, develop, and maintain systems that automate financial data sync between Rippling and ERPs like NetSuite and QuickBooks.
  • Analyze and debug issues in complex, distributed systems to improve reliability and performance.
  • Contribute to code reviews and adopt engineering best practices to ensure high-quality, maintainable code.
  • Participate in the design and discussion of new product features, bringing a fresh perspective to solving real customer problems.
  • Learn Rippling’s tech stack and architecture while receiving mentorship and support from experienced engineers.
  • Continuously improve through team-led workshops, 1:1 mentorship, and on-the-job learning.
  • Play an active role in shaping the future of accounting automation at Rippling.

What you will need

  • 1–2 years of experience at fast-paced, high-growth product companies.
  • Proficiency in one or more programming languages such as Java, Python, C++, or Go.
  • Strong grasp of computer science fundamentals including data structures, algorithms, and software design principles.
  • Understanding of system design concepts and distributed systems architecture.
  • Ability to write clean, maintainable, and efficient code while maintaining a fast development velocity.
  • Clear communication skills and the ability to work collaboratively in a cross-functional team
  • A proactive mindset with eagerness to learn new technologies and tackle real-world engineering challenges
  • Bonus: Open source contributions, competitive programming experience, or a strong CS foundation from a Tier 1 institution
  • Tech Stack: Python, Go, Postgres, Kafka, Kubernetes, gRPC, AWS.

Apply Now for Rippling Software Engineer Job

How to Apply Rippling Off Campus Drive 2025

Click on Apply to Official Link Rippling Above – You will go to the Company Official site
First of all Check, Experience Needed, Description and Skills Required Carefully.
Stay Connected and Subscribe to Jobformore.com to get Latest Job updates from Jobformore for Freshers and Experienced.

Interview Questions

  • Can you describe a project where you built a feature using Python or Go?
  • How do you ensure scalability in distributed systems or integrations?
  • What is your approach to debugging issues in a complex system like Kafka?
  • Can you share an example of contributing to a code review process?
  • How do you collaborate with product managers to define feature requirements?
  • What familiarity do you have with AWS or Kubernetes in development?
  • How do you maintain clean and efficient code under tight deadlines?
  • Can you explain your understanding of system design or data structures?
  • What strategies do you use to stay updated with backend tech trends?
  • How would you contribute to Rippling’s mission of automating financial data?
Photo of author

Authored By Shahul

Shahul, a career content creator from Kurugonda, India, empowers job seekers with tech industry insights, focusing on software development, automation testing, and data engineering. As a Telugu native, he offers relatable career advice through jobformore.com and other platforms.

Leave a Comment